Message type: E = Error
Message class: OQ_C - IS-Oil SSR : Message pool Fuels
Message number: 356
Message text: Enter a length greater than 0

- Enter a length greater than 0 ?The SAP error message OQ_C356 "Enter a length greater than 0" typically occurs in the context of material management or production planning when a user is trying to enter a value that is either zero or negative in a field that requires a positive length value. This can happen in various transactions, such as creating or modifying production orders, purchase orders, or material master records.
Cause:
- Invalid Input: The user may have entered a length value of zero or a negative number in a field that requires a positive value.
- Field Configuration: The field may be configured to only accept positive values, and the input does not meet this requirement.
- Data Entry Error: A simple typographical error or oversight during data entry.
Solution:
- Check Input Values: Ensure that the value entered in the relevant field is greater than zero. If you are entering a length, make sure it is a positive number.
- Review Field Requirements: Check the documentation or field help to understand the requirements for the specific field you are working with.
- Correct Data Entry: If you find that you have mistakenly entered an invalid value, correct it and try saving or processing the transaction again.
